Definition

a food item consisting of one or more types of bread with fillings, such as meats, cheeses, or vegetables, typically eaten as a light meal

Usage note

While 'sandwich' is a common noun, its informal synonyms like 'sub' or 'hoagie' are regional. The term can also refer to the act of placing something between two other things.
